Apple‘s amazing increase in value is more than just a “rah-rah” story for a turnaround.  Fundamentally, Apple is telling everyone – globally – that there has been a tectonic shift in markets. And if leaders don’t understand this shift, and incorporate it into their strategy and tactics, their organizations are going to have a very difficult future.

Recently Apple’s value peaked at $600B.  Yes, that is an astounding number, for it reflects not only 50% greater value than the oil giant Exxon/Mobil (~$390B), but more than the entire value of the stock markets in Spain, Greece and Portugal combined!
